Common Carrier HVAC Problems We Solve in Tierra Buena

  • Infinity condenser fan motor failures during sustained 105°F+ heat. Tierra Buena sits in the Sacramento Valley heat corridor where summer highs regularly exceed 105–110°F for weeks. That sustained peak load burns out fan motor bearings faster than intermittent cycling. We stock OEM Carrier fan motors and test amp draw against factory spec, not just “does it spin.”
  • Heat exchanger cracks in aluminized steel models. The extreme temperature swing from dense Tule fog winters near freezing to triple-digit summer peaks stresses metal fatigues. We inspect with borescope cameras and combustion analyzers. Cracked exchangers mean replacement, not repair, and we’ll show you the image.
  • Evaporator coil clogging from September–October rice harvest. Sutter County’s rice chaff creates filter-fouling conditions unknown in Yuba City’s suburbs. We’ve seen coils packed solid within three weeks of harvest start. Our pre-harvest maintenance in August is essentially mandatory for Tierra Buena Carrier owners.
  • Gas valve sticking on propane-fired Carrier furnaces. Tierra Buena’s lack of natural gas lines means propane orifice sizing and sulfur content become critical. Sulfur residue causes intermittent ignition failures, that clicking-with-no-flame pattern that frustrates rural homeowners. We clean, test, and replace valves with propane-rated OEM components.
  • Duct leakage and cooling loss in 140°F attics. Tierra Buena’s older rural homes often have mid-century ductwork routed through unconditioned attic spaces. Flex duct separates at seams, metal duct rusts through. We seal with mastic and test static pressure to verify the fix, not just tape and hope.

Carrier Service in Tierra Buena: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

Tierra Buena’s lack of natural gas lines means Carrier propane furnaces and heat pumps dominate here, requiring specialized knowledge of propane orifice sizing and sulfur-induced valve failures absent in Yuba City Carrier service neighborhoods. A contractor who swaps a natural gas valve onto a propane Carrier furnace without changing the orifice plate creates a dangerous over-firing condition. We’ve seen it. The flame rollout scorches the cabinet, trips the high-limit, and the homeowner gets a cold house plus a safety hazard. In Tierra Buena, we carry propane conversion kits and verify BTU input with a manometer on every furnace service. The rice harvest dust compounds everything: a propane furnace already running slightly rich due to a dirty burner orifice becomes a sooting mess by October. That’s why our August pre-harvest tune-ups for Carrier systems on rural parcels off Tierra Buena Road and Garden Highway include burner removal and orifice inspection, not just a filter swap and a glance at the thermostat. Generic maintenance checklists from suburban shops don’t account for this.
